China will remain a major player in textiles

The organiser of Intertextile Shanghai, Messe Frankfurt, has expressed confidence in China’s ability to maintain a leading position in the global textile industry, in spite of trade tensions and competition from other countries.

Speaking at the spring 2025 edition of the event, the managing director of Messe Frankfurt’s Hong Kong division, Wendy Wen, said the textile industry in China continues to evolve and that high levels of innovation in materials and in production  are in evidence there.

She said these developments and the comprehensiveness of the textile supply chain in China, spanning everything from raw materials to finished garment manufacturing, meant China will remain “a major player”, in spite of current challenges.

“China is very advanced,” Ms Wen said. “There is always competition, not least from countries such as India, which is also very strong in production and has a large domestic consumer market. But, in textiles, India is 10 or 15 years behind China.”
